I apologize for the delay in response on this. If you are able to try the latest beta version, there may be a fix.
I am a little unclear as to how you are running VTune. Are you running from within Visual Studio? The screenshots appear to be from the standalone version. You also mention adding the application name and parameters. If you run from the Visual Studio toolbar (select "Configure Analysis..." from the side-ways triangle option), you can automatically import the VS project settings. I realize the documentation doesn't mention this step.
The sep driver appears to be installed just fine. But it seems that it's having trouble with the instrumentation (PIN), usually due to trying to instrument a privileged binary. It is odd that you get the error with the matrix sample.
